What’s the launch plan (when? how? what? etc) of Zebra client. Love to hear via a blog post on how Zebra is going to go live.
Thanks! Seems like alpha release is scheduled for Dec 8th. good to find out mainnet release
I’d like to know if it’s Linux only for now or we can build it on macs/windows?
It compiles fine on macOS (I run the client on my machine).
Zebra dev here. It should run on macs / windows just fine.
As you already saw, our alpha release is planned for the 8th. We haven’t posted blog posts yet because this is very much an alpha release. Zebra’s architecture is mostly filled out but we’re missing most of the validation logic. Right now we only support syncing and storing the block chain and a few critical consensus checks. We do validate proof of work and bitcoin merkle roots, so we shouldn’t diverge from zcashd without expensive work being done to mislead zebra. This alpha release is aimed at establishing our release process, support process, and ironing out bugs in the supporting storage and networking code. Once we start filling out the rest of the validation logic and approaching our first stable release we will be taking the time to blog about zebra’s design extensively, we already have quite a few blog posts planned out.
Do you think there is room for outside developers to contribute to Zebrad? If so what areas specifically do you think they would be most helpful in?
Absolutely! We already have two open source contributors and would love more. It’s hard to say exactly what would be the best area to hop in, but we will happily sit down to figure that out given interest. We already have a lot of issues tagged as open to contributors: Issues · ZcashFoundation/zebra · GitHub, and there are probably plenty of other issues that could be worked on by outside developers with coordination. I recommend checking out our milestones if you want a better idea of upcoming projects (I’d drop a link but discourse wont let me include more than two links in this post): Milestones - ZcashFoundation/zebra · GitHub.
If you or anyone else is interested in contributing definitely drop by our Github / Discord and let us know. We have a weekly sync meeting every Monday at 9pm GMT/1pm PST in our discord that anyone is welcome to join or you can just drop a message in the zebra channel at any time.
Relevant links:
- zfnd discord: Zcash Foundation
- zebra repo: GitHub - ZcashFoundation/zebra: A Rust implementation of a Zcash node. 🦓
- our weekly planning document: 2021 Engineering Team Gardening Agenda - Google Docs
Sorry about that, fixed, it’s the spam filter, because you don’t post much. Bumped up your trust level
tyvm, and fixed